Subarachnoid Hemorrhage – When a Mind Aneurysm Bleeds

Spontaneous subarachnoid (pronounced sub-uh-RACK-noid) hemorrhage is rightfully probably the most feared reason for sudden headache. Normally attributable to rupture of aneurysms (irregular, balloon-like outpouchings of arteries) positioned close to the bottom of the mind, subarachnoid hemorrhages contain bleeding into the house between the mind and its surrounding membrane, generally known as the meninges. A traumatic blow to the top may trigger subarachnoid hemorrhage, however this can be a utterly unrelated course of and isn’t the topic of this essay.

About 10% of individuals with spontaneous subarachnoid hemorrhages die earlier than they even get to a hospital and over a 3rd die inside the first 4 weeks following the bleed. Survivors can have important impairments attributable to mind injury.

And whereas the consequences of the preliminary bleed are dangerous sufficient, in the following couple of weeks people with subarachnoid hemorrhage can undergo further, severe problems. One complication is that the aneurysm chargeable for the preliminary hemorrhage can bleed a second time and trigger much more injury. This happens in 4% of instances inside the first 24 hours and there may be one other 1.2% probability of re-bleeding every day thereafter for the primary two weeks. Thus, with out remedy 20% of instances have a second hemorrhage inside the first two weeks.

The opposite severe complication is that the blood deposited within the subarachnoid house could cause in any other case wholesome arteries passing by this house to enter spasm. The spasm decreases blood-flow to the elements of the mind ordinarily nourished by these arteries and thereby inflicts further injury. Or, stated one other method, a blocked artery causes a brand new stroke, this time of the non-bleeding kind. For causes that aren’t solely understood, these spasms of the arteries don’t happen inside the first few days after the preliminary hemorrhage. As an alternative, they sometimes develop after a delay of 4-9 days.

What will be executed to scale back these problems? Within the case of blood-vessel spasm, the most effective remedy is a preventive one. Administering a drug known as nimodipine (prononounced nye-MO-dih-peen) intravenously makes spasming much less prone to happen. However with a view to forestall the opposite main complication, re-bleeding, the most effective remedies are these which bodily stabilize the aneurysm. In a single such process, a surgeon locations a steel clip throughout the aneurysm the place it joins the in any other case regular artery. Another surgical procedure is to wrap the skin of the aneurysm with surgical gauze or plastic sheeting. A more moderen process includes filling the aneurysm with tiny steel coils inserted by way of a versatile catheter snaked by the arteries.

How can one inform if a selected headache is brought on by a bleeding aneurysm? It may be a troublesome name, however sure options make a ruptured aneurysm extra seemingly. First, a headache attributable to a ruptured aneurysm is often of very abrupt onset (typically described as a “thunderclap”) and is classically the worst headache of 1’s life. In individuals who have already got recurrent extreme complications from different causes, the headache attributable to a ruptured aneurysm would possibly really feel completely different from the extra normal assaults.

Medical analysis of sufferers with ruptured aneurysms can flip up further clues, like a stiffened neck or adjustments within the backs of the eyes made seen by an ophthalmoscope. In fact, if the affected person is drowsy or confused, this would possibly recommend that one thing severe is occurring, as would any new impairment within the potential to maneuver the eyes, an arm or a leg. A computed tomographic (CT) scan of the top carried out inside the first 24 hours may be very delicate in detecting a hemorrhage, but when the scan is delayed it’s much less in a position to detect the bleed. A lumbar puncture (also called a spinal faucet) at all times detects subarachnoid hemorrhage even when it’s a few days previous, but when the needle causes bleeding by piercing a blood-vessel on its strategy to the subarachnoid house, the take a look at would possibly give the misunderstanding {that a} subarachnoid hemorrhage occurred when it hadn’t.

After discovery of subarachnoid hemorrhage, the following spherical of testing focuses on the place precisely the bleeding occurred. Whereas in over two-thirds of the instances it originates from ruptured aneurysms, different potential sources embody tangles of irregular blood-vessels generally known as arteriovenous malformations or from bleeds inside the mind tissue that secondarily leak into the subarachnoid house. The managing doctor can order any of three assessments to picture the blood vessels themselves and pinpoint the supply of bleeding.

The oldest test–still thought-about the gold-standard–is generally known as an arteriogram or, alternatively, an angiogram. An arteriogram is taken into account an “invasive” take a look at as a result of the physician should slide an extended, versatile catheter by the arterial system (which is underneath a lot larger strain than the veins) in order that dye infused by the catheter will enter the arteries in query. Two newer assessments are “non-invasive,” although, in reality, they typically contain an infusion right into a vein. One is magnetic resonance arteriography (MRA) which is carried out with the assistance of an MRI-scanner. The opposite is computed tomographic arteriography (CT-A) which is carried out with the assistance of a CT-scanner. Whereas the non-invasive assessments are getting higher on a regular basis, they nonetheless sometimes miss aneurysms in any other case seen on arteriograms.

Subarachnoid hemorrhages happen yearly in about 10 folks out of 100,000. This computes to a 0.01% charge of annual prevalence. Distinction this determine with the 12% of the adult inhabitants who’ve migraine (most of whom have at the least one extreme headache per 12 months) and it’s obvious that the overwhelming majority of extreme complications will not be attributable to ruptured aneurysms. However the concern about lacking a ruptured aneurysm implies that many individuals with out subarachnoid hemorrhage should obtain assessments with a view to diagnose the few who’ve it.

What causes aneurysms within the first place? A couple of issue is concerned. First, there will be an inborn weakening of the artery’s wall. When the wall subsequently deteriorates in methods that may be accelerated by hypertension and smoking, an aneurysm can kind.

Really, aneurysms affecting the mind’s arteries are pretty widespread. Post-mortem and arteriogram research point out that about 1-4% of the overall inhabitants have them. That is many extra folks than have subarachnoid hemorrhages, so a logical conclusion is that most individuals with aneurysms undergo their complete lifetimes with out having signs. Research present that aneurysms lower than 5 millimeters (0.2 inches) in diameter have a really low charge of rupture, whereas aneurysms larger than 10 millimeters (0.4 inches) in diameter have a major threat of bleeding.

Do ruptured aneurysms run in households? A 2005 report from the Scottish Aneurysm Examine Group confirmed a slight tendency for this trait to be shared by shut kin. The ten-year threat for subarachnoid hemorrhage in first-degree kin (mother and father, siblings and youngsters) was 1.2%. The chance was even decrease in additional distant kin. In households with two affected first-degree kin there was a development towards larger threat. The authors felt that the majority kin of sufferers struggling subarachnoid hemorrhages have low threat of future hemorrhages, and that routine screening of relations is inappropriate until there are a number of affected people in the identical household.
